BBC Strictly Come Dancing have announced the return of their judges for the 2021 season. However, there is a new face among the judging panel! Anton Du Beke is set to replace Bruno Tonioli as a judge for 2021.

BBC strictly sees the return of their judges. Craig Revel Horwood, Motsi Mabuse and head judge Shirley Ballas are set to return. Bruno Tonioli usually is the fourth judge and normally films both BBC’s strictly come dancing alongside ABC’s Dancing With The Stars. However, last year due to covid restrictions Bruno was unable to fly back to film the UK’s Strictly Come Dancing. This called for a last minute replacement, Anton Du Beke. Anton is much loved by the public and viewers of the show and received a great response when filling in as a judge on the show.

This year, Anton will replace Bruno on the show for the whole series. Anton Du Beke will now have a permanent place on the judging panel for the 2021 series. Since the announcement, Anton has put out statements on his social media pages. Anton says, ‘I’m absolutely thrilled to bits to be joining these wonderful judges!
